Struct AngularAxisMotor
- Namespace
- BepuPhysics.Constraints
- Assembly
- BepuPhysics.dll
Constrains the relative angular velocity of two bodies around a local axis attached to body A to a target velocity.
public struct AngularAxisMotor : ITwoBodyConstraintDescription<AngularAxisMotor>, IConstraintDescription<AngularAxisMotor>
- Implements
- Inherited Members
Fields
LocalAxisA
Axis of rotation in body A's local space.
public Vector3 LocalAxisA
Field Value
Settings
Motor control parameters.
public MotorSettings Settings
Field Value
TargetVelocity
Target relative angular velocity around the axis.
public float TargetVelocity
Field Value
